5. Installation Guide

Important: Installation should only be performed by a qualified HVAC technician. Incorrect installation can lead to serious hazards.

  1. Power Disconnection: Turn off all electrical power to the furnace at the main circuit breaker or fuse box. Verify power is off using a voltage tester.
  2. Access the Igniter: Locate and remove the furnace access panel(s) to expose the burner assembly and existing igniter.
  3. Disconnect Wiring: Carefully disconnect the electrical connector from the old igniter. Note the routing of the wires.
  4. Remove Old Igniter: Unmount the old igniter from its bracket. It may be secured by screws or clips. Handle the old igniter carefully as it may be fragile.
  5. Inspect Mounting: Ensure the mounting bracket is clean and free of debris.
  6. Install New Igniter: Mount the new ERP ER1401 igniter onto the bracket, ensuring it is securely fastened and positioned correctly according to the furnace manufacturer's specifications. Avoid touching the silicon carbide element with bare hands, as oils can shorten its lifespan.
  7. Connect Wiring: Connect the electrical connector of the new igniter to the furnace wiring harness. Ensure a secure connection.
  8. Secure Panels: Replace all furnace access panels.
  9. Restore Power: Turn on the electrical power to the furnace at the main circuit breaker.
  10. Test Operation: Initiate a heating cycle to verify the igniter functions correctly and the furnace lights reliably. Observe the igniter glowing and igniting the gas.

6. Operation

The ERP ER1401 Furnace Igniter operates as part of the furnace's ignition sequence. When the thermostat calls for heat, the furnace control board sends power to the igniter. The silicon carbide element heats up rapidly to a high temperature, glowing red-hot.

Once the igniter reaches its operating temperature, the gas valve opens, releasing gas into the burner assembly. The hot igniter then ignites the gas, creating a flame. A flame sensor detects the presence of the flame, signaling the control board to keep the gas valve open and the igniter to turn off (in intermittent pilot systems) or remain on (in hot surface ignition systems, depending on furnace design). If no flame is detected, the furnace will typically attempt to re-ignite or enter a lockout state for safety.

8. Troubleshooting

If your furnace is not igniting or experiencing issues, the igniter may be a contributing factor. Always ensure power is disconnected before inspecting furnace components.

ProblemPossible CauseSolution
Igniter does not glow.No power to furnace, faulty igniter, faulty control board, loose wiring.Check circuit breaker. Verify wiring connections. Test igniter for continuity (requires multimeter and expertise). Consult a qualified technician.
Igniter glows but gas does not ignite.No gas supply, faulty gas valve, igniter not hot enough, igniter positioned incorrectly, faulty flame sensor.Check gas supply. Ensure igniter is correctly positioned. Inspect flame sensor. Consult a qualified technician.
Igniter glows, gas ignites, but furnace cycles off quickly.Faulty flame sensor, dirty flame sensor, poor ground connection.Clean or replace flame sensor. Check furnace grounding. Consult a qualified technician.

Note: Troubleshooting furnace issues can be complex and dangerous. If you are unsure, always contact a qualified HVAC professional.
